§ 31-8-164. Provider Fee Based on Patient Day; Quarterly Payment Required
Each nursing home shall be assessed a provider fee with respect to each patient day for the preceding quarter, excluding medicare program patient days. The provider fee shall be assessed uniformly upon all nursing homes, except as provided in Code Section 31-8-168. § 31-8-167. Annual Report by Department to General Assembly
The department shall report annually to the General Assembly on its use of revenues deposited into the segregated account and appropriated to the department pursuant to this article. History. Code 1981, § 31-8-167 , enacted by Ga. L. 2003, p. 435, § 2.

§ 31-8-169. Application of the Medical Assistance Act of 1977
Except where inconsistent with this article, the provisions of Article 7 of Chapter 4 of Title 49, the “Georgia Medical Assistance Act of 1977,” shall apply to the department in carrying out the purposes of this article. History. Code 1981, § 31-8-169 , enacted by Ga. L. 2003, p. 435, § 2.

§ 31-8-170. Legislative Authority
This article is passed pursuant to the authority of Article III, Section IX, Paragraph VI(i) of the Constitution. History. Code 1981, § 31-8-170 , enacted by Ga. L. 2005, p. 505, § 1/HB 392.
